Pyeongchon Centum First, sold by DL E&C, is being developed through the redevelopment of Deokhyeon District into a complex consisting of 23 buildings ranging from 3 basement floors to 38 above-ground floors, with a total of 2,886 households and exclusive areas ranging from 36 to 99㎡.

This complex offers easy access to Pyeongchon infrastructure, including the Pyeongchon academy district, Lotte Department Store, and Anyang City Hall. It is also well-located near the station area, with the planned opening of Hogyesageori Station (tentative name) on the Dongtan-Indeogwon Line scheduled for 2027.


Excellent product design is another factor that enhances the value of this complex. It offers a wide range of unit sizes from small to medium, broadening the choices for buyers, and secures an outstanding parking space ratio of 1.45 cars per household. The on-site gymnasium is a rare facility in Korea, equipped with LED floor lines that can be set according to the sport, allowing flexible use as a basketball court, badminton court, tennis court, and more.


The exterior design and landscaping facilities suitable for a large complex are also noteworthy. To express the prestige of the complex, a curtain wall look design was applied to some buildings, and high-end stone finishes were used in the common areas on the first floor above ground. Glass railing windows were installed instead of steel window frames, adding a sophisticated feel and modern architectural beauty.


Pyeongchon Centum First is a post-sale complex scheduled for move-in in November, and with the reduced sale price, units up to the 72㎡ type (excluding some floors) are eligible for special benefits under the Special Home Loan Program.


The sale price of Pyeongchon Centum First is set at an average of 28.9 million KRW per 3.3㎡ after a 10% discount. The discounted price for the 59㎡ units is around 710 million KRW on average. Considering that the price of apartments of the same size in the nearby area, which have been occupied for three years, reached up to 685 million KRW and the current asking prices range from 670 million to 750 million KRW, this is regarded as a reasonable level.
